Astra Agro Lestari (AALI) is traded on Jakarta Exchange in Indonesia and employs 28,465 people. The company currently falls under 'Mega-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 15.73 T. Market capitalization usually refers to the total value of a company's stock within the entire market. To calculate Astra Agro's market, we take the total number of its shares issued and multiply it by Astra Agro's current market price. To manage market risk and economic uncertainty, many investors today build portfolios that are diversified across equities with different market capitalizations. However, as a general rule, conservative investors tend to hold large-cap stocks, and those looking for more risk prefer small-cap and mid-cap equities. Astra Agro Lestari operates under Food Products sector and is part of Consumer Staples industry. The entity has 1.92 B outstanding shares. Astra Agro holds a total of 1.92 Billion outstanding shares. Astra Agro Lestari shows majority of its outstanding shares owned by insiders. An insider is usually defined as a corporate executive, director, member of the board or institutional investor who own at least 10% of the company's outstanding shares. 79.69 percent of Astra Agro Lestari outstanding shares that are owned by insiders signifies that they have been buying or selling the stock in recent months in anticipation of some upcoming event.
